Job Description
WHAT'S THE JOB?
Reporting to the Regional Operations Director, the District Manager (DM) is responsible for overseeing multiple units or portfolios for a specific region to ensure efficiency and effectiveness and execute the strategic vision of the Senior Leadership Team. District Managers foster long term relationships by delivering operational excellence to meet client and customer needs. Strong attention to detail with the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ast paced and deadline driven environment. The DM also provides direction and expertise to the region by promoting corporate strategies and best practices aligned with our Vision and Values.
D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
This role holds expansive responsibilities for the performance of multiple contracts across their district. The key areas they are responsible for include:
Full P&L and financial responsibility for the sites and locations in their district
Total Revenue equivalent to +/- $25 Million and multiple accounts
Promote the company values and be a leader in health and safety
Client relationships, engagement, Net Promotor scores, contract extensions
People management of all operations resources and support functions within their region
Training and professional development of core operational staff at the site level
Successful interactions with support functions to ensure their region is compliant with corporate vision and priorities
Mentor and train all direct reports; direct conduit to site level leaders
Plans, oversees and operationalizes the business plan in the region
Develops plans and budgets to meet financial targets; accountable for key financial and performance measures including cost control, EBITDA and customer ratings scores
With support of the Regional Operations Director, facilitates, manages, and builds client relationships
Manage multiple field leadership team to ensure compliance with proper procedures and guidelines
Strengthen operational processes to build highly efficient and effective operations
Liaise with Regional Operations Director and other DM’s and ensure the consistent implementation of strategic initiatives to all field operation groups
Provide leadership of the field operations team ensuring effective performance management and continued development
Support the implementation of operational improvements in the areas of safety, quality, customer service, finance, and employee performance
Communicate and share company standards and available resources that assist facility operations
Identify gaps and opportunities and determine root causes in operating standards and overall guest satisfaction
Coordinate with other department leaders to find solutions to problems
Establish clear business goals and financial targets with the Manager of each location
Identify opportunities and best practices to improve profitability of locations
Ensure compliance with employment standards, human rights, health and safety, and WHMIS within all regions
Assist in effectively and efficiently managing the development of the Hospitality Operations team to promote high quality customer service and satisfaction
Other related duties incidental to the work described herein
